Denis Lachaud J'apprends l'Allemand
roman
Ernst, raised in France, seeks his family history, veiled by a generation of silence, and finds his identity as a German and as a homosexual, through his relationship with a friend he meets on school exchange to Germany. This is a book about the third generation - the grandchildren of the Nazis - and the ways that collective guilt, whether spoken of or not, shapes their experience of the world and understandings of themselves
